Hirekingdom’s referral system offers significant benefits for both job seekers and employers, creating a mutually advantageous environment for recruitment. For job seekers, it enhances their chances of landing desirable positions by leveraging personal networks, allowing them to tap into referrals from friends or colleagues already within the company. This personal endorsement often boosts their credibility and visibility in the hiring process. For employers, the referral system helps identify high-quality candidates more efficiently, as referrals are typically pre-vetted and more likely to fit the company culture. Additionally, it reduces recruitment costs and time, fostering a more engaged and committed workforce, ultimately leading to better retention rates. This symbiotic relationship fosters a collaborative hiring approach, benefiting all parties involved.

Labor Surplus Area how would compensation and benefits be affected?

In a labor surplus area, where the supply of workers exceeds demand, employers may have greater leverage to offer lower compensation and benefits, as job seekers compete for fewer available positions. This can lead to wage stagnation or even reductions, as employers may not need to offer competitive pay to attract candidates. Additionally, benefits packages may be less generous, as companies focus on cost-cutting in a more favorable hiring environment. Overall, the dynamics typically result in less favorable conditions for workers in surplus areas.
